Alternative Wedding Bouquets!

Want an ‘out-of-the-box’ feel for your wedding? Not a problem!  Just because you don’t want to dye your hair bright fuschia or wear a tie-dye wedding dress doesn’t mean you can’t add a little flavour into the mix.

Alternative bouquets are a great way to keep things classy but also guarantee that not only your dress will be turning heads!

When you are looking for your perfect bouquet, make sure it not only resembles your theme, but also a little piece of YOU in the mix. If you are more of an outgoing and spunky type of bride, feathers and beads are going to reflect that bold personality!  These elements can also be brought into the decor of your special.  For example, embellishments on your table numbers, subtle accents in your centrepieces or motifs in the stationary.  There are a number of ways these elements can come together to give a cohesive feel to your day!

If you are more on the conservative side, vintage lace and soft fabric ‘flower’ bouquets are definitely something to look into.  Perfect for that vintage or natural vibe:)...you even get a little whimsy!

These are wonderful DIY projects for those ladies that are ambitious!  Another DIY project that you can consider is this beauty below!  A brooch bouqet - simply stunning!  This will be where you skills as a "collector" come in :)  Start early for this one!

These bouquets can be more than just an accessory for your stunning ensemble, but can also tie you into the theme of your wedding that much more!  Anything from romantic beach to rustic forest themed bouquets help with enriching the theme and ensuring your guests are in “awe” by the hard work you’ve put in.

One thing to remember with choosing your alternative bouquet is to be creative. These are the small details that make a big impact and you are guaranteed that you won’t be the only one who notices the unique difference.
